Installing The Lord of the Rings: The Two Towers can be a bit of a quest itself, especially since the classic movie-tie-in action game was never officially ported to PC. While its sequel, The Return of the King, received a PC release, fans of The Two Towers must use emulation to experience it on modern hardware.
